In the Porcine kitchen, Hill and his team break down a whole Berkshire or Duroc pig each week, turning it into a gorgeous, French-inspired fare that pulls no punches like creamy, rillettes-like cretons with a hillock of savoury puy lentils or a croquette stuffed with meat from the head on a vintage skewer. Farmers have the final say on the menu at sustainable Surry Hills restaurant The Blue Door, with executive chef Dylan Cashman only serving dishes based on whats available from his personal network of local producers. For over a decade, Andrew Bao and Dingjun Li showcased the fiery, sour and smoky flavours of Hunanese cuisine at Chairman Mao in Kensington.
